How did the development of early cities affect people's daily lives?

Respuesta :

Kalahira
Kalahira Kalahira
  • 14-11-2017
These cities allowed it for people to communicate and trade more easily. They were able to trade goods and services. This impacted the education of people. This also had a negative impact as it increased the likelihood of disease and violence.
